The History of Ramen

Ramen has a rich history that dates back to the late 19th century in Japan. Originally influenced by Chinese noodle dishes, ramen quickly evolved into a distinct culinary tradition. Here are some key points in ramen's history:

  • Late 1800s: Ramen was introduced to Japan by Chinese immigrants.
  • 1900s: The first ramen shop opened in Yokohama.
  • 1958: Instant ramen was invented, revolutionizing the way people consumed this dish.
  • 1970s-1980s: Ramen gained popularity outside of Japan, leading to the establishment of ramen shops worldwide.

Different Types of Ramen

Ramen comes in various styles, each with its unique flavors and ingredients. Here are some popular types of ramen:

Shoyu Ramen

Shoyu ramen features a soy sauce-based broth, offering a savory and slightly sweet flavor profile. It is often served with toppings like sliced pork, green onions, and nori.

Miso Ramen

Miso ramen uses a miso-based broth, giving it a rich and hearty taste. This style often includes corn, butter, and a variety of vegetables.

Shio Ramen

Shio ramen is a salt-based broth that is lighter and more delicate. This style is typically garnished with seafood and vegetables.

Tonktotsu Ramen

Tonkotsu ramen features a creamy pork bone broth, known for its rich and hearty flavor. It is often topped with sliced chashu, green onions, and soft-boiled eggs.

Ramen Call Back Recipes

Here are a couple of easy recipes to try at home:

Basic Shoyu Ramen Recipe

  • Ingredients:
    • Ramen noodles
    • 4 cups chicken broth
    •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
    • 1 tablespoon mirin
    • Toppings: Chashu, green onions, nori, soft-boiled eggs
  • Instructions:
    • Cook ramen noodles according to package instructions.
    • In a pot, combine chicken broth, soy sauce, and mirin. Heat until warm.
    • Assemble the ramen bowls with noodles, broth, and desired toppings.

Miso Ramen Recipe

  • Ingredients:
    • Ramen noodles
    • 4 cups vegetable broth
    • 3 tablespoons miso paste
    • Toppings: Corn, butter, scallions, and bean sprouts
  • Instructions:
    • Cook ramen noodles according to package instructions.
    • In a pot, combine vegetable broth and miso paste. Stir until miso is dissolved.
    • Assemble the ramen bowls with noodles, broth, and desired toppings.
